Use the rain protector that comes with your bag. I just make sure I put them back into the bag as dry as poss. If its been a really bad day, when i get home I re-dry all the clubs and give them a good clean.
 
Dry grips, hands and gloves is the main priority. I would take at least 2 spare gloves and 2 towels in a plastic bag within the golf bag.
Umbrella holder on trolley helps keep rain off grips as it's covering the top of the bag all the time.
Obviously waterproof top and bottoms but if its warm amd raining I don't mind getting upper half a bit damp, rather that that too happed up.
 
Tend not to bother with a brolly unless it is lashing and then mainly to keep a spare towel and glove inside. Make sure you have lots of towels and gloves and a good set of waterproofs. I tend to keep my spare gloves in a sandwich bag (take them out when I get home) to keep them dry as most bags absorb some water.

I don't worry too much about the rainhood for the same reason but make sure I wipe the grips before I play usually after I've taken my practice swing so they are as dry as possible for the shot
 
The rain hood that comes with the bag is usually useless. If you trolley it, get a proper rain cover. If you carry, get a sun mountain h2o.

Other than that, get a water proof hat, a good set of goretex, and a rain glove. Sorted.
